Income Statement

A financial document that reports a company's financial performance over a specific accounting period, detailing revenues, expenses, and profits.

Dividend Yield Ratio

A financial ratio that shows how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its share price.

Par Value

A nominal value assigned to a security or stock as stated in the corporate charter.

Dividend Payout Ratio

This is a financial ratio that measures the percentage of earnings paid to shareholders in the form of dividends.
